Keweenaw Adventure Company
Established in 1994, Keweenaw Adventure Company (KAC) specializes in Lake Superior sea kayak adventures and mountain biking on Copper Harbor’s internationally recognized trail system. We offer a variety of guided day trips for both activities, as well as multi-day kayak tours on Isle Royale National Park and along the Keweenaw Water Trail. KAC has a small retail shop w ... More here we host a supply of essential bike parts and kayak accessories, bicycle, canoe, sit-on-top kayak, SUP rentals, bicycle service (mechanics), eco-interpretive hikes, and a shuttle service. More than just a retail shop, we have also built our reputation as advocates, trail builders, community organizers, and folks who like to have a good time – and also folks that like to promote trail safety and etiquette, too!
